: Set during the Mexican Revolution, it follows Tita, the youngest daughter of the De La Garza family. Due to a rigid family tradition, she is forbidden from marrying so she can care for her mother until death. como agua para chocolate alfonso arau 1992mkv 60 better
The 1992 Mexican cinematic masterpiece Como Agua Para Chocolate (Like Water for Chocolate), directed by , remains a landmark of Latin American "magical realism".
